摘要
中国每年通过煤矿乏风排放大量的甲烷到大气中。不仅造成了资源的浪费,而且加剧了温室效应。笔者总结并比较了几种煤矿通风瓦斯处理和利用技术,并对其应用前景进行了展望。
Emissions of ventilation air methane (VAM) from all the mines around the world is considerable. It is not only a waste of energy but also exacerbating the greenhouse effect. This article summarizes and compares different technologies to treatment and utilize the VAM. Economic and environmental prospects of the technologies is described.
